From f2b996a31273dc4e77f08a8bc15eeddce178567c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Sun, 17 May 2026 04:19:35 +0000 Subject: [PATCH] chore(deps): bump tower in /services/catalog-service Bumps [tower](https://github.com/tower-rs/tower) from 0.4.13 to 0.5.3. - [Release notes](https://github.com/tower-rs/tower/releases) - [Commits](https://github.com/tower-rs/tower/compare/tower-0.4.13...tower-0.5.3) --- updated-dependencies: - dependency-name: tower dependency-version: 0.5.3 d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] --- services/catalog-service/Cargo.lock | 46 ++++------------------------- services/catalog-service/Cargo.toml | 2 +- 2 files changed, 6 insertions(+), 42 deletions(-) diff --git a/services/catalog-service/Cargo.lock b/services/catalog-service/Cargo.lock index cbc18d1..3be85ea 100644 --- a/services/catalog-service/Cargo.lock +++ b/services/catalog-service/Cargo.lock @@ -120,7 +120,7 @@ dependencies = [ "serde_urlencoded", "sync_wrapper", "tokio", - "tower 0.5.3", + "tower", "tower-layer", "tower-service", "tracing", @@ -231,7 +231,7 @@ dependencies = [ "thiserror 1.0.69", "tokio", "tokio-retry", - "tower 0.4.13", + "tower", "tower-http", "tracing", "tracing-subscriber", @@ -460,7 +460,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"39cab71617ae0d63f51a36d69f866391735b51691dbda63cf6f96d042b63efeb" dependencies = [ "libc", - "windows-sys 0.61.2", + "windows-sys 0.52.0", ] [[package]] @@ -1130,7 +1130,7 @@ version = "0.50.3"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"7957b9740744892f114936ab4a57b3f487491bbeafaf8083688b16841a4240e5" dependencies = [ - "windows-sys 0.61.2", + "windows-sys 0.59.0", ] [[package]] @@ -1239,26 +1239,6 @@ version = "2.3.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"9b4f627cb1b25917193a259e49bdad08f671f8d9708acfd5fe0a8c1455d87220" -[[package]] -name = "pin-project" -version = "1.1.13"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"2466b2336ed02bcdca6b294417127b90ec92038d1d5c4fbeac971a922e0e0924" -dependencies = [ - "pin-project-internal", -] - -[[package]] -name = "pin-project-internal" -version = "1.1.13"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c96395f0a926bc13b1c17622aaddda1ecb55d49c8f1bf9777e4d877800a43f8b" -dependencies = [ - "proc-macro2", - "quote", - "syn", -] - [[package]] name = "pin-project-lite" version = "0.2.17" @@ -2184,23 +2164,6 @@ dependencies = [ "tokio", ] -[[package]] -name = "tower" -version = "0.4.13"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"b8fa9be0de6cf49e536ce1851f987bd21a43b771b09473c3549a6c853db37c1c" -dependencies = [ - "futures-core", - "futures-util", - "pin-project", - "pin-project-lite", - "tokio", - "tokio-util", - "tower-layer", - "tower-service", - "tracing", -] - [[package]] name = "tower" version = "0.5.3" @@ -2212,6 +2175,7 @@ dependencies = [ "pin-project-lite", "sync_wrapper", "tokio", + "tokio-util", "tower-layer", "tower-service", "tracing", diff --git a/services/catalog-service/Cargo.toml b/services/catalog-service/Cargo.toml index 21ae2b4..28ce8d0 100644 --- a/services/catalog-service/Cargo.toml +++ b/services/catalog-service/Cargo.toml @@ -10,7 +10,7 @@ path = "src/main.rs" [dependencies] axum = { version = "0.7", features = ["macros"] } tokio = { version = "1", features = ["full"] } -tower = { version = "0.4", features = ["timeout", "limit", "util"] } +tower = { version = "0.5", features = ["timeout", "limit", "util"] } tower-http = { version = "0.5", features = ["trace", "cors", "compression-gzip"] } serde = { version = "1", features = ["derive"] } serde_json = "1"